Foundation jacking services involve the process of lifting and stabilizing a building's fo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or structural movement. This technique typically uses hydraulic jacks to carefully raise the foundation back to its original position, often in conjunction with underpinning methods to reinforce the soil beneath. The goal is to restore the stability of the property, prevent further damage, and improve the overall safety and integrity of the structure. Skilled contractors assess the specific needs of each property to determine the appropriate approach for effective foundation stabilization.

These services are primarily sought to resolve problems such as u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ible signs of foundation movement. Over time, soil conditions, moisture changes, or poor construction can lead to foundation settlement, which can compromise the structure’s stability. Foundation jacking helps mitigate these issues by realigning the foundation and providing additional support where necessary. Properly executed foundation jacking can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future, safeguarding the property's value and usability.

Foundation jacking is applicable to a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-unit complexes. Older houses that have experienced shifting over the years often require this service to maintain their structural integrity. Commercial properties, such as retail stores or office buildings, may also benefit from foundation stabilization to ensure safety and compliance with building standards. In regions with expansive clay soils or significant moisture fluctuations, foundation jacking offers a proactive solution to address ongoing settlement concerns.

Cost of Foundation Jacking - Typical costs for foundation jacking services generally range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work and property size. For example, lifting a small residential foundation might cost around $3,500, while larger or more complex projects can exceed $12,000.

Factors Affecting Pricing - The total cost can vary based on soil conditions, foundation size, and access difficulty. In Williamson County, IL, projects with challenging access or extensive repairs may see prices closer to the upper end of the range.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Some service providers charge between $10 and $25 per square foot for foundation jacking, with costs increasing for additional stabilization or repairs needed after lifting. Larger homes typically benefit from a lower cost per square foot.

Additional Expenses - Costs may also include permits, inspection fees, and potential repairs to surrounding structures, which can add several thousand dollars to the total project budget.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
